Understanding the Foundations: Egg Cooker Fundamentals

Think of your egg cooker as a steam-powered hero. The heart of this dependable gadget is a simple heating element which turns water into steam. The level of water you add controls the heat generated and indirectly, the cooking time!

The Unsung Heroes: Heating Element and Water Reservoir

At the base of the egg cooker is a heating element similar to those in an electric kettle. Surrounding this, you will find the water reservoir. Once you add water and switch on the device, the heating element warms the water and converts it into steam.

The Midway Station: Egg Tray

A tier above the water reservoir and heating element, there resides the egg tray. This is where you place your eggs, ready to soak up all that steamy goodness. These trays often have small hollows to hold the eggs safely, but I would recommend poking a small hole at the top of each egg to prevent them from cracking under pressure.

Science in the Kitchen: The Role of Steam

When you switch on the device, the heating element gets to work and starts transforming water into steam. Remember, steam is just hot water in gas form. So, essentially, we are cooking eggs with hot water just like traditional methods, but in a much more efficient manner.

The generated steam rises upwards and envelops the eggs on the tray. The heat from the steam cooks the eggs evenly from all sides, leading to a perfect boil – every single time!

Automatic Shut-Off: The Clever Trick

The water level determines the amount and hence, the duration of steam produced. Different egg cookers might come with measuring cups indicating water levels for soft, medium, and hard-boiled eggs. Once all the water is used up, the temperature inside the egg cooker rises. This prompts a built-in thermostat to switch off the device – a cunning feature to ensure you don't end up with overcooked rubbery premolars’ nightmare.

Keep It Clean, Folks

Clean the egg cooker regularly. Mineral deposits from the water may accumulate over time and affect the heating efficiency.

Vent It Out

Yes, your egg cooker needs to breathe, too! Make sure that the steam vent is clean, and steam can escape freely. Blocked vents could build pressure and potentially ruin your beloved egg cooker.

All Good Things Must Come to an End

When your egg cooker meets its natural expiration date, accept it graciously. Usually, a failed heating element or faulty thermostat is a telltale sign that your gadget has cooked its last egg.
